Output d5f53f7f9d30129110a5c8c95463631ba43cdce34a7476806c39d0a008621fd1:1

value
21251723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f2a2bafaa56560e8282ee50848063d78b5b7fc2 OP_EQUAL
address
MCCYWWnL1v6L7AyYK1Mvhny6DvEkymhUbE
transaction
d5f53f7f9d30129110a5c8c95463631ba43cdce34a7476806c39d0a008621fd1
spent
true